Dorette
doh-REHT
Dorette is a girl’s name of Greek origin, meaning “A diminutive of Dora or Dorothy, both derived from the Greek name Dorothea meaning 'gift of God'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1954.

The Story of Dorette
This charming diminutive carries the full weight of a divine gift, a sweet spirit destined for a life of kindness.
Dorette is a diminutive form, often linked to Dora or the longer Dorothy. Both ultimately trace back to the Greek 'doron' and 'theos,' meaning 'gift of God.' This sweet, graceful name emerged in the early to mid-20th century.
